

| Written by James Holoboff, Process Ecology In this article we focus on a new feature in HYSYS v7 which will be of interest to many HYSYS users - support for various reboiler configurations in the column, available from the Input Expert. The HYSYS release notes outline features and enhancements in a number of different areas, summarized at the end of this article. Reboiler Configurations When a reboiled absorber or distillation column are added using the Input Expert, a new page is available which provides some options for setting up the reboiler in HYSYS: |
| Users now have the ability to select a different reboiler type or a different circulation option: Reboiler Configuration |
| If the default selection is used – “Once-through” and “Regular Hysys reboiler”, then the reboiler will be set up exactly as it has been done previously. The column subflowsheet appears as follows: |
